The Importance of Regular Dental Care

Maintaining good oral health is crucial for overall well-being. Regular visits to Austin dentists play a pivotal role in preventing dental issues and ensuring your teeth and gums remain in optimal condition. Here are some key benefits of regular dental care:

  • Prevention of Dental Problems: Regular check-ups allow dentists to identify issues such as cavities, gum disease, and oral cancer early, which significantly increases the chances of successful treatment.
  • Professional Cleanings: Professional dental cleanings remove plaque and tartar buildup that regular brushing and flossing may miss, contributing to healthier gums and teeth.
  • Overall Health Link: Oral health is linked to overall health. Poor dental hygiene can lead to systemic health issues such as heart disease and diabetes.
  • Confidence Boost: A healthy smile boosts self-esteem and confidence, allowing you to interact more freely in social and professional settings.

What to Expect During Your Visit to an Austin Dentist

Your first visit to an Austin dentist may include a comprehensive examination of your oral health, recording of your dental history, and a discussion of any concerns you may have. Here’s a typical overview of what to expect:

Initial Consultation

During your initial consultation, the dentist will ask about your medical history, including any medications you're taking and any past dental work. Be prepared to discuss your dental habits and any problems you are experiencing.

Comprehensive Examination

The dentist will perform a thorough examination of your teeth, gums, and mouth. This may include:

  • Visual Inspection: Checking for cavities, gum disease, and other conditions.
  • X-rays: Taking X-rays to identify issues that are not visible during a visual examination.
  • Screening for Oral Cancer: Assessing any abnormal spots that could indicate oral cancer.

Treatment Options

If any issues are identified, your Austin dentist will discuss treatment options with you. Common treatments include:

  • Cavity Filling: If cavities are detected, they can be filled with materials that restore tooth structure.
  • Scaling and Root Planing: For gum disease, deep cleaning may be necessary to remove tartar and bacteria.
  • Cosmetic Treatments: Options such as whitening, veneers, and bonding to enhance your smile.

Wide Range of Services Offered by Austin Dentists

Austin dentists offer a comprehensive range of dental services to meet the varying needs of their patients. Understanding the services available can empower you to make informed decisions about your dental care. Here are some of the primary categories of services provided:

General Dentistry

General dental care forms the cornerstone of your oral health. Services in this category include:

  • Routine Check-ups and Cleanings: Regular examinations and professional cleanings to maintain oral health.
  • Fillings: Treatment of cavities to restore the integrity of teeth.
  • Preventive Care: Educational resources on brushing, flossing, and dietary choices that impact dental health.

Cosmetic Dentistry

Beautiful smiles can be achieved through a variety of cosmetic procedures offered by Austin dentists. These services include:

  • Teeth Whitening: Fast and effective treatments to brighten your smile significantly.
  • Veneers: Thin shells placed over teeth to improve aesthetics.
  • Invisalign: Clear aligners that straighten teeth discreetly.

Restorative Dentistry

Restorative dentistry focuses on repairing damaged or missing teeth. Key services include:

  • Dental Implants: Permanent replacements for missing teeth that look and act like natural teeth.
  • Crowns and Bridges: Solutions for restoring the function and appearance of teeth.
  • Root Canals: Treatment for infected teeth to prevent extraction.

Emergency Dentistry

Dental emergencies can happen at any time. Austin dentists are equipped to handle situations such as:

  • Severe Toothaches: Immediate relief for painful dental conditions.
  • Broken or Chipped Teeth: Quick assessment and treatment options to restore your smile.
  • Lost Fillings or Crowns: Immediate care to protect and preserve your dental health.

The Role of Technology in Modern Dentistry

Modern dentistry has evolved significantly thanks to technological advancements. Austin dentists now employ a variety of technologies to enhance the patient experience and treatment outcomes. Some notable technologies include:

  • Digital X-rays: Provide clearer images and reduce radiation exposure.
  • CAD/CAM Systems: Allow for same-day crowns and restorations to save time and improve convenience.
  • Laser Dentistry: Minimally invasive treatments that reduce discomfort and promote faster healing.
